Own an iconic Highlands estate at 889 Horse Cove Road. - Originally built in 1881, this home is one of the original homes ever built in Highlands. - The Harris family for whom Harris Lake is named was part of the original family. - The home was remodeled creating a Guest Cottage, a Garden Shed and vegetable garden, added lush landscaping and a water feature. - The kitchen is reconfigured and totally updated with new appliances. - The home was selected for the Bascom's Annual Garden Tour in 2007 and for the *Tour of Historic Homes* in 2009. - The main home has four bedrooms and three and one-half baths. - The adorable Guest Cottage has one bedroom with a loft sleeping area, a full bath, a kitchen and a spacious great room with stone fireplace. - A view of Satulah Mountain is seen from the dining porch. - This is an authentic Historic Highlands Home whose character and charm have been retained-it is an *Irreplaceable Antique.* - This is truly a legacy property on 1.43 acres close to the heart of Highlands. - Owner/Brokers.
